The Godzilla King of Monsters story is about the giant monster Godzilla. Godzilla is a powerful and ancient creature that rises to protect the Earth from other menacing monsters. It shows Godzilla's battles against various threats, often in big, action - packed scenes where he uses his atomic breath and immense strength to defeat his foes.
In the Godzilla King of Monsters story, Godzilla is like a force of nature. There are other Titans in this world too. Godzilla has to face off against them to maintain a sort of balance. For example, some Titans may be causing destruction that could end life on Earth, and Godzilla steps in. The story also delves into the idea of how humans interact with these colossal beings. Sometimes they try to control them, but usually, it just makes things more complicated.
The Godzilla King of Monsters story is a thrilling saga. Godzilla is the king of the monsters for a reason. He has survived for ages and his presence is both terrifying and reassuring. The story involves a lot of destruction as these giant Titans clash. There are also sub - plots about the human characters who are either trying to study Godzilla and the other Titans or trying to use them for their own purposes. However, in the end, it is Godzilla who emerges as the ultimate protector of the planet, using his unique abilities to fend off any threats to Earth's existence.
